Output 1bd5de52ef17d0906b143eb8052f8a205679f02c59967aae6ff9a71c3c281852:0

value
28136776
script pubkey
OP_HASH160 OP_PUSHBYTES_20 773afc9fd75bb001cd1a056377c3c2b84474770a OP_EQUAL
address
3CZSzr6SLYZq2yUfDbmwpupAJUahuUrQ9g
transaction
1bd5de52ef17d0906b143eb8052f8a205679f02c59967aae6ff9a71c3c281852
spent
true